Rockola Mystic Touch Screen Wall Jukebox – hang it, stroke it and listen carefully

Rockolamystictouchjukebox

This Rockola Mystic Touch Screen Wall Jukebox comes across like an overgrown Wurlitzer. It sports drag and drop playlist creation, a 19 inch touch screen, a 160 GB hard drive, USB and iPod ports (natch!) and a 260 watt output through twin speakers. It all sounds very nice, but we can’t help thinking that £3,295.00 sounds a tad excessive for what is effectively an iPod and dock on steroids. Maybe we’re missing something…?

 The Rockola Mystic isn’t just a pretty face! It literally oozes technology. The ‘Auto Magic Touchscreen’ allows you to virtually thumb through your collection! There are no complicated hidden drop-down menus, no difficult-to-master mouse-type devices or direction arrows, no confusing, hard-to-see buttons cramped too closely together. You see what you want on the screen, you touch it with your finger, and you drag it to the play area. It’s that simple!
